Performance: “I Am Here” 

July 09, 20218:30 p.m.
MADRID
Casa Árabe garden (at Calle Alcalá, 62). 8:30 p.m. Free entry.

On Friday, July 9, we will be hosting this performance, which resulted from the workshop given for three days by Nezha Rhondali at the Casa Árabe headquarters in Madrid, as part of the event series “Entretanto.” Also taking part in the session is musician Slimane Alaoui Ismaili.

Each of our body’s movements changes the space we occupy. The waving of a hand or an arm, all the joints which make up our presence, allow us to create countless ways of inhabiting urban space.

French-Moroccan dancer Nezha Rhondali will be guiding us through this three-day workshop, in a process of acknowledgment and dialogue between the self and others, oneself and space. It is a proposal which focuses on the three connections of the SELF, consisting of  experimenting with different ways of “being here” along with ten participants.

As a result of the workshop, Casa Árabe invites its public to attend and participate in the final performance to be held in the building’s outdoor space on Friday, July 9 at 8:30 p.m. The event will take the form of an improvised dance event that workshop participants will share with the public and with Slimane Alaoui Ismaili, a Moroccan multi-instrumentalist musician (bagpipe, qraqab and percussion).
